Chip sealing services involve applying a layer of liquid asphalt to an existing pavement surface, followed by the spreading of aggregate chips. This process creates a durable, protective surface that enhances the longevity of the pavement while providing a textured finish. The application typically includes cleaning the surface, applying the asphalt binder, and then distributing the aggregate material evenly across the area. Once the chips are set, the surface is often rolled to ensure proper adhesion and a smooth finish, resulting in a sealed and reinforced pavement.
This service helps address common pavement problems such as surface cracking, oxidation, and deterioration caused by weather exposure and regular wear. Over time, asphalt surfaces can develop small cracks and surface erosion, which, if left untreated, may lead to more significant damage or potholes. Chip sealing acts as a preventive measure by sealing the surface and preventing water infiltration, which can weaken the underlying layers. It also provides a cost-effective way to extend the lifespan of existing pavement without the need for complete reconstruction.

Cost Range for Chip Sealing - Typically, the cost for chip sealing services varies between $0.50 and $2.00 per square foot. For example, a 1,000-square-foot driveway might cost approximately $500 to $2,000 depending on materials and conditions.
Factors Influencing Price - Costs can fluctuate based on the size of the area, surface condition, and local labor rates. Larger projects or those requiring surface repairs tend to increase overall expenses.
Average Project Expenses - On average, homeowners in Lakeland, FL, might expect to pay around $1,000 to $3,000 for chip sealing a standard driveway. Commercial or extensive areas could cost significantly more.

What is chip sealing? Chip sealing is a pavement preservation method that involves applying a layer of asphalt followed by embedding aggregate stones to protect and extend the life of existing roads or driveways.
How long does a chip seal driveway last? The longevity of a chip seal surface depends on traffic and maintenance, but typically it can last several years before requiring resealing or repairs.
Is chip sealing suitable for residential driveways? Yes, chip sealing can be used on residential driveways to improve durability and appearance, especially for areas with heavy traffic or existing cracking.
What are the benefits of chip sealing? Chip sealing provides a cost-effective way to extend pavement life, improve skid resistance, and enhance the appearance of roads or driveways.
How is chip sealing different from asphalt paving? Unlike asphalt paving, chip sealing involves a layered application of asphalt and aggregate, making it a less expensive option for surface preservation and repair.
